On some platforms(such as Hip06/Hip07), the legacy ISA/LPC devices access
I/O with some special host-local I/O ports known on x86. As their I/O space
are not memory mapped like PCI/PCIE MMIO host bridges, this patch is meant
to support a new class of I/O host controllers where the local IO ports of
the children devices are translated into the Indirect I/O address space.

Through the handler attach callback, all the I/O translations are done
before starting the enumeration on children devices and the translated
addresses are replaced in the children resources.

+/*
+ * update/set the current I/O resource of the designated device node.
+ * after this calling, the enumeration can be started as the I/O resource
+ * had been translated to logicial I/O from bus-local I/O.
+ *
+ * @child: the device node to be updated the I/O resource;
+ * @hostdev: the device node where 'adev' is attached, which can be not
+ *  the parent of 'adev';
+ * @res: double pointer to be set to the address of the updated resources
+ * @num_res: address of the variable to contain the number of updated resources
+ *
+ * return 0 when successful, negative is for failure.
+ */
+int acpi_set_logicio_resource(struct device *child,
+               struct device *hostdev, const struct resource **res,
+               int *num_res)
+{
+       struct acpi_device *adev;
+       struct acpi_device *host;
+       struct resource_entry *rentry;
+       LIST_HEAD(resource_list);
+       struct resource *resources = NULL;
+       int count;
+       int i;
+       int ret = -EIO;
+
+       if (!child || !hostdev)
+               return -EINVAL;
+
+       host = to_acpi_device(hostdev);
+       adev = to_acpi_device(child);
+
+       /* check the device state */
+       if (!adev->status.present) {
+               dev_info(child, "ACPI: device is not present!\n");
+               return 0;
+       }
+       /* whether the child had been enumerated? */
+       if (acpi_device_enumerated(adev)) {
+               dev_info(child, "ACPI: had been enumerated!\n");
+               return 0;
+       }
+
+       count = acpi_dev_get_resources(adev, &resource_list, NULL, NULL);
+       if (count <= 0) {
+               dev_err(&adev->dev, "failed to get ACPI resources\n");
+               return count ? count : -EIO;
+       }
+
+       resources = kcalloc(count, sizeof(struct resource), GFP_KERNEL);
+       if (!resources) {
+               dev_err(&adev->dev, "No memory for resources\n");
+               acpi_dev_free_resource_list(&resource_list);
+               return -ENOMEM;
+       }
+       count = 0;
+       list_for_each_entry(rentry, &resource_list, node)
+               resources[count++] = *rentry->res;
+
+       acpi_dev_free_resource_list(&resource_list);
+
+       /* translate the I/O resources */
+       for (i = 0; i < count; i++) {
+               if (resources[i].flags & IORESOURCE_IO) {
+                       ret = acpi_translate_logiciores(adev, host,
+                                                       &resources[i]);
+                       if (ret) {
+                               kfree(resources);
+                               dev_err(child, "Translate I/O range FAIL!\n");
+                               return ret;
+                       }
+               }
+       }
+       *res = resources;
+       *num_res = count;
+
+       return ret;
+}
